Ejector Pump Installation in Auburn, AL

Ejector pump installation services provide a practical solution for homeowners dealing with basement or crawl space wastewater management. These systems are designed to handle sewage or greywater that cannot flow naturally by gravity, by pumping it from lower levels to the main sewer line. Projects typically involve installing ejector pumps in areas where plumbing fixtures are below the main sewer line or in homes with finished basements, ensuring efficient and reliable removal of waste. Property owners often want to understand the scope of installation, the system’s compatibility with existing plumbing, and the maintenance requirements to ensure long-term performance.

Before requesting ejector pump installation, property owners should consider the size and capacity needed for their household or project, as well as the location where the system will be installed. It’s important to evaluate the existing plumbing layout, potential space constraints, and the power supply availability. Clarifying these details can help determine the most suitable ejector pump system and ensure proper setup for effective waste removal. Proper installation is essential for preventing backups and ensuring the system functions smoothly over time.

FAQ

Ejector Pump Installation Questions

What is an ejector pump used for? Ejector pumps help remove wastewater from areas below the main sewer line, such as basements or crawl spaces.

When is installation of an ejector pump needed? Installation is necessary when plumbing fixtures are located below the sewer line level or where gravity drainage isn't possible.

What types of projects typically require an ejector pump? Common projects include basement bathrooms, laundry rooms, and other below-grade plumbing additions.

How does an ejector pump work? It collects wastewater and uses a mechanism to pump it upward to the main sewer line for proper disposal.
